Summary

SF5008 is a bill designed to address public health concerns related to lead exposure, specifically by appropriating funds for lead risk assessments in certain municipalities. The bill allocates a total of $500,000 for fiscal year 2025, aimed at the Minneapolis Health Department and the St. Paul-Ramsey County Public Health Department. These funds are earmarked for conducting lead risk assessments for children with elevated blood lead levels, thereby proactively tackling a significant health issue in these communities.
